
Ingredients :
- 1 lb stew meat
- 2 tbsp oil
- 1/2 cup flour
- 2 cup beef broth
- 1 large onion, chopped
- 2 stalk celery
- 1 cup chopped carrot
- 4 medium Potatoes
- 1 can tomato paste or stew starter
- 2 tsp Italian seasoning
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1 envelope stew seasoning
- 1 can corn
- can green beans
- 1 can peas
Method :
- Heat 2 tbs of oil over medium heat
- Add flour and beef to a gallon sized bag and shake until well coated
- Add floured beef to the skillet and season with salt and pepper. Stir until browned.
- Meanwhile chop the onion, carrots, celery, and potatoes. Then add to the slow cooker.
- Next the beef should be done. Pour the cooked beef over the veggies.
- Return the skillet to the stove and deglaze the pan with all the crunchy bits with the beef broth.
- Add the tomato paste or stew starter and the Italian season and a little pepper and a pinch or salt.
- Pour it over the beef and veggies. Add stew seasoning packet and stir.
- Cook on low for 8 hrs or high for 4hrs.
- The last 20 minutes you can add canned or frozen veggies such and corn, peas, or green beans. Whatever you like.
